Graphlens plugins read configuration from the host environment. GRAPHLENS_DEPTH caps traversal depth, GRAPHLENS_LAYOUT selects the renderer, and GRAPHLENS_CACHE_DIR must be writable. Plugins that resolve private package metadata must authenticate against the Parcelmoor registry; anonymous queries are rejected. Declare all variables you consume in your plugin manifest. The registry credential belongs in your env file on the line below.

vault entry, yahif-yajep: COURIER_KEY29=b802bdf8034096b65a51c6ba5abe2

# ReceiptRelay — donation-receipt mailer for the Gildenhart Foundation.
# Heads up, release folks: this service batches receipts every 15 minutes
# and sends through the Plumewire relay, so a bad config means donors get
# nothing until the next window. Template changes go through staging first,
# no exceptions — we learned that the hard way last spring. Everything
# below is safe to commit except the relay credential, which must be the
# next line after this comment:

secret setting of yajog-taguf: ARCHIVE_KEY3=051

## Tuning

Load tests hit the Quickbasket checkout flow end-to-end, including the fraud-check stub. Rate limits and lockout thresholds stay enabled during runs so results reflect production posture. Adjust ramp and concurrency only via the constants file; ad-hoc overrides are rejected at startup. The current values are:

tuning table, faduf-baduf:
PRIORITIES = {
    "ulavan": 191,
    "silys": 750,
    "goriel": 238,
    "kelmir": 66,
    "wendor": 432,
}

### Step 4: Recalibrate drift compensation

After upgrading Greenhollow controllers to firmware 3.2, humidity sensors read ~4% high until drift compensation is rebaselined. Run the recalibration job once per bay, nights only. Do not skip bays with legacy probes; they drift fastest. The job reads the controller's active settings, which must match the values below.

service settings:
[pelius]
port = 5432
team = praius
host = pelius.crelvoforge.internal
region = upper-4
access_code = ac_8f224d
timeout_ms = 2000